[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#629259: ATI RADEON 9200 freezes on Squeeze with firmware-linux-nonfree



On 06/05/2011 04:49 AM, Ben Hutchings wrote:
On Sun, 2011-06-05 at 02:46 +0200, burek pekaric wrote:
Package: firmware-linux-nonfree
Severity: critical
Justification: breaks the whole system

I'm trying for several days to get my display up and running on fresh install
of Debian Squeeze. I was looking to find the original drivers from the OEM here
http://support.amd.com/us/gpudownload/Pages/linux64-radeon-prer200.aspx but
there are just .rpm packages so I've checked here
http://wiki.debian.org/AtiHowTo in order to finally get my screen to display
more than a couple of colors, but..

After installing the package firmware-linux-nonfree and reboot, I couldn't even
get to the login screen, because display would stuck just before the background
image of the login screen was fully displayed (animated/faded out). The display
would just freeze and that's it. The mouse would respond for the next couple of
seconds and it would also die. From that moment on only physical reset button
could be of any help :(

Trying to figure out what the problem is (and how to stop loading of gnome to
have the simple shell login, so I can remove the package), I've found the key
combination Ctrl+Alt+F1 and Ctrl+Alt+Backspace.
You should boot to single-user mode.  In the GRUB menu, this is labelled
as 'recovery mode'.  If you use LILO, add an entry with 'append=single'.

On next reboot I tried
constantly pressing these combinations and finally somehow I've got the console
login without GUI, which has let me to login just to show me the message like
this one (several seconds after the login): "... [drm:radeon_fence_wait]
*ERROR* fence(...) 510ms timeout going to reset GPU" and after that, again it
just froze.
Please provide the complete messages.

I don't really know what is wrong here, maybe even I've made some wrong steps,
but this really influenced me to stop thinking about switching to Linux,
although I'd really like to give it a try and not give up this easy, but when
the most basic stuff can't work out-of-the-box (like the display driver) it
really makes me feel uncomfortable to proceed any further :/ No offence..

Is there any command I can type or anything I can do to give you a more
detailed report, so that this issue can be resolved?
'lspci -vnn' would be helpful, in additional to the kernel log messages.

Ben.


Hi,

1. Thanks for the tip for single user mode.
2. How to provide complete messages? What command should I type or what log file should I attach?
3. Here is the output:

# lspci -vnn

00:00.0 Host bridge [0600]: Intel Corporation 82865G/PE/P DRAM Controller/Host-Hub Interface [8086:2570] (rev 02)
    Subsystem: ASUSTeK Computer Inc. Device [1043:8103]
    Flags: bus master, fast devsel, latency 0
    Memory at e0000000 (32-bit, prefetchable) [size=256M]
    Capabilities: [e4] Vendor Specific Information: Len=06 <?>
    Capabilities: [a0] AGP version 3.0
    Kernel driver in use: agpgart-intel

00:01.0 PCI bridge [0604]: Intel Corporation 82865G/PE/P PCI to AGP Controller [8086:2571] (rev 02) (prog-if 00 [Normal decode])
    Flags: bus master, 66MHz, fast devsel, latency 64
    Bus: primary=00, secondary=01, subordinate=01, sec-latency=64
    I/O behind bridge: 0000c000-0000cfff
    Memory behind bridge: fe100000-fe1fffff
    Prefetchable memory behind bridge: bff00000-dfefffff

00:06.0 System peripheral [0880]: Intel Corporation 82865G/PE/P Processor to I/O Memory Interface [8086:2576] (rev 02)
    Flags: fast devsel
    Memory at fecf0000 (32-bit, non-prefetchable) [size=4K]

00:1d.0 USB Controller [0c03]: Intel Corporation 82801EB/ER (ICH5/ICH5R) USB UHCI Controller #1 [8086:24d2] (rev 02) (prog-if 00 [UHCI]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 16
    I/O ports at ef00 [size=32]
    Kernel driver in use: uhci_hcd

00:1d.1 USB Controller [0c03]: Intel Corporation 82801EB/ER (ICH5/ICH5R) USB UHCI Controller #2 [8086:24d4] (rev 02) (prog-if 00 [UHCI]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 19
    I/O ports at ef20 [size=32]
    Kernel driver in use: uhci_hcd

00:1d.2 USB Controller [0c03]: Intel Corporation 82801EB/ER (ICH5/ICH5R) USB UHCI Controller #3 [8086:24d7] (rev 02) (prog-if 00 [UHCI]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 18
    I/O ports at ef40 [size=32]
    Kernel driver in use: uhci_hcd

00:1d.3 USB Controller [0c03]: Intel Corporation 82801EB/ER (ICH5/ICH5R) USB UHCI Controller #4 [8086:24de] (rev 02) (prog-if 00 [UHCI]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 16
    I/O ports at ef80 [size=32]
    Kernel driver in use: uhci_hcd

00:1d.7 USB Controller [0c03]: Intel Corporation 82801EB/ER (ICH5/ICH5R) USB2 EHCI Controller [8086:24dd] (rev 02) (prog-if 20 [EHCI]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 23
    Memory at febffc00 (32-bit, non-prefetchable) [size=1K]
    Capabilities: [50] Power Management version 2
    Capabilities: [58] Debug port: BAR=1 offset=00a0
    Kernel driver in use: ehci_hcd

00:1e.0 PCI bridge [0604]: Intel Corporation 82801 PCI Bridge [8086:244e] (rev c2) (prog-if 00 [Normal decode])
    Flags: bus master, fast devsel, latency 0
    Bus: primary=00, secondary=02, subordinate=02, sec-latency=64
    I/O behind bridge: 0000d000-0000dfff
    Memory behind bridge: fe200000-feafffff

00:1f.0 ISA bridge [0601]: Intel Corporation 82801EB/ER (ICH5/ICH5R) LPC Interface Bridge [8086:24d0] (rev 02)
    Flags: bus master, medium devsel, latency 0

00:1f.1 IDE interface [0101]: Intel Corporation 82801EB/ER (ICH5/ICH5R) IDE Controller [8086:24db] (rev 02) (prog-if 8a [Master SecP PriP]) Subsystem: ASUSTeK Computer Inc. P4P800/P5P800 series motherboard [1043:80a6]
    Flags: bus master, medium devsel, latency 0, IRQ 18
    I/O ports at 01f0 [size=8]
    I/O ports at 03f4 [size=1]
    I/O ports at 0170 [size=8]
    I/O ports at 0374 [size=1]
    I/O ports at fc00 [size=16]
    Memory at 40000000 (32-bit, non-prefetchable) [size=1K]
    Kernel driver in use: ata_piix

00:1f.3 SMBus [0c05]: Intel Corporation 82801EB/ER (ICH5/ICH5R) SMBus Controller [8086:24d3] (rev 02)
    Subsystem: ASUSTeK Computer Inc. P4P800 Mainboard [1043:80a6]
    Flags: medium devsel, IRQ 17
    I/O ports at 0400 [size=32]
    Kernel driver in use: i801_smbus

00:1f.5 Multimedia audio controller [0401]: Intel Corporation 82801EB/ER (ICH5/ICH5R) AC'97 Audio Controller [8086:24d5] (rev 02)
    Subsystem: ASUSTeK Computer Inc. P4P800 Mainboard [1043:80f3]
    Flags: bus master, medium devsel, latency 0, IRQ 17
    I/O ports at e800 [size=256]
    I/O ports at ee80 [size=64]
    Memory at febff800 (32-bit, non-prefetchable) [size=512]
    Memory at febff400 (32-bit, non-prefetchable) [size=256]
    Capabilities: [50] Power Management version 2
    Kernel driver in use: Intel ICH

01:00.0 VGA compatible controller [0300]: ATI Technologies Inc RV280 [Radeon 9200] [1002:5961] (rev 01) (prog-if 00 [VGA controller])
    Subsystem: C.P. Technology Co. Ltd Device [148c:2063]
    Flags: bus master, 66MHz, medium devsel, latency 64, IRQ 16
    Memory at d0000000 (32-bit, prefetchable) [size=128M]
    I/O ports at c000 [size=256]
    Memory at fe1f0000 (32-bit, non-prefetchable) [size=64K]
    Expansion ROM at fe1c0000 [disabled] [size=128K]
    Capabilities: [58] AGP version 3.0
    Capabilities: [50] Power Management version 2
    Kernel driver in use: radeon

01:00.1 Display controller [0380]: ATI Technologies Inc RV280 [Radeon 9200] (Secondary) [1002:5941] (rev 01)
    Subsystem: C.P. Technology Co. Ltd Device [148c:2062]
    Flags: bus master, 66MHz, medium devsel, latency 64
    Memory at c8000000 (32-bit, prefetchable) [size=128M]
    Memory at fe1e0000 (32-bit, non-prefetchable) [size=64K]
    Capabilities: [50] Power Management version 2

02:05.0 Ethernet controller [0200]: 3Com Corporation 3c940 10/100/1000Base-T [Marvell] [10b7:1700] (rev 12) Subsystem: ASUSTeK Computer Inc. A7V600/P4P800/K8V motherboard [1043:80eb]
    Flags: bus master, 66MHz, medium devsel, latency 64, IRQ 22
    Memory at feafc000 (32-bit, non-prefetchable) [size=16K]
    I/O ports at d800 [size=256]
    Capabilities: [48] Power Management version 2
    Capabilities: [50] Vital Product Data
    Kernel driver in use: skge

02:0c.0 Communication controller [0780]: Intel Corporation 536EP Data Fax Modem [8086:1040]
    Subsystem: Intel Corporation Device [8086:1000]
    Flags: bus master, medium devsel, latency 64, IRQ 5
    Memory at fe400000 (32-bit, non-prefetchable) [size=4M]
    Capabilities: [e0] Power Management version 2





Reply to: